Optimizing Payment Gateways for Enhanced Security and Efficiency

In today's digital landscape, ensuring robust security and seamless efficiency in payment gateways is paramount. Merchants must prioritize the implementation of advanced security measures to safeguard sensitive customer data from unauthorised access. Integrating industry-standard encryption protocols, such as SSL/TLS, is crucial for encrypting payments during transmission, protecting them from interception. Additionally, employing multi-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security by requiring users to provide multiple forms of identification before granting access. Furthermore, optimizing payment gateways for efficiency involves streamlining the checkout process, minimizing friction for customers and reducing cart abandonment rates.

Forecasting the future of Payment Processing: Trends and Innovations

The payment processing landscape is constantly evolving with innovative technologies influencing how we transact. From the rise of contactless payments and mobile wallets to the integration of blockchain and artificial intelligence, the future of payment processing is brimming with opportunity. One key trend is the transition towards open banking, which allows for integrated financial services. This will empower consumers to have greater control over their financial data and interact with financial institutions in more dynamic ways.

  • Moreover, the use of biometrics, such as fingerprint and facial recognition, is growing as a robust form of authentication.
  • In addition, real-time payments are gaining popularity worldwide, shortening settlement times and optimizing the overall payment experience.

With these advancements, the future of payment processing promises to be transformative. We can expect to see even more disruptive solutions that optimize financial transactions and empower consumers, businesses, and markets alike.
